With the growth of economic and the acceleration in the process of urbanization, traffic jams are becoming big problems that restrict the development of china's cities. As one of means to solve the problem, congestion pricing has aroused concern and discussion between scholars. Limited to describe alone concept, or the problem of how to identify kinds of vehicles or whether traffic demand being flexible, however, the study on congestion pricing in exiting literature shortfalls in core issues, such as how to implement congestion pricing, and how to determine the range of regional for congestion pricing. On the base of discussion to the toll rate, the main goal of this thesis is studying how to determine the range of regional for traffic pricing, at the same time, the thesis also discuss the feasibility study about congestion pricing. This work will be help in implementing the strategy.According to investigation of the domestic and foreign commonly-used theory, this thesis systemically researches the models of congestion pricing in concept, principle and method by theoretical analysis and technological comparing research. The main aspects are as follows:The concept and estimation basis of traffic congestion are formulated; the principles of economics used in congestion pricing are formulated; because land resources are becoming scarce, congestion pricing is demonstrated to be effective; at last, a mathematical model is founded on basis of optimization theory of bi-level programming.Researching the model and solving algorithm based on traffic flow dynamic distribution is the focus of this thesis. Two core issues of congestion pricing will be considered in the model:1) How to determine the range of regional for congestion pricing. It means a clear size of the regional and concrete position of the tollgate will be in question.2) How to determine the toll rate. It is mainly in quest of an algorithm for dynamic pricing.At last, an example root from Beijing city's expressway network is used to simulate the mathematical model, and a program that make use of MATLAB to compute the model is compiled. Because lack of conditions, the data isn't sufficient, however, the conclusion is still available.
